Fancourt’s The Links is a meticulously crafted, Gary Player–designed course opened in 2000 and widely regarded as South Africa’s top layout. Built on reclaimed land and shaped to mimic classic Scottish and Irish links, it features dramatic dunes, pot bunkers, firm fairways, and sweeping coastal-style vistas. The course is a par 73 and has hosted major events, including the 2003 Presidents Cup. With immaculate conditioning, world-class practice facilities, and a private, exclusive atmosphere, The Links delivers a demanding yet inspiring championship experience. It combines pure links tradition with modern precision, making it one of the world’s premier golf courses.

Fun Fact:
The Links at Fancourt was built on an old airfield.
Host To:
2003 Presidents Cup, 2005 SA Open
